The Essence of Live Dealer Games

Live Dealer Games offer an interactive experience akin to a physical casino. Players engage with real dealers via live video streaming, adding a layer of authenticity. The games typically include:

  • Real-time interaction with dealers
  • Higher stakes and betting limits
  • Social elements, such as chatting with other players

These games often have a Return to Player (RTP) percentage ranging between 90% to 98%, depending on the specific game variant.

The Mechanics of RNG Games

In contrast, RNG games use algorithms to determine game outcomes. These games are designed for speed and convenience, allowing players to enjoy gaming without waiting for a dealer or other players. Key features include:

  • Instantaneous results
  • Availability of numerous game types, including slots and table games
  • Customization options, such as autoplay features

RNG games typically boast an RTP of approximately 85% to 97%, making them appealing for players seeking rapid gameplay.

Comparison of Key Features

Feature Live Dealer Games RNG Games
Game Speed Moderate Fast
Social Interaction High Low
RTP Percentage 90% – 98% 85% – 97%
Minimum Bet Higher Lower
Game Variety Limited Extensive

Advantages and Disadvantages

Live Dealer Games

  • Pros:
    • Authentic casino atmosphere
    • Real-time interaction
    • Higher RTP percentages
  • Cons:
    • Longer wait times
    • Higher minimum bets
    • Limited game variety

RNG Games

  • Pros:
    • Fast-paced gameplay
    • Wider range of games
    • Lower betting limits
  • Cons:
    • No social interaction
    • Potentially lower RTP
    • Less authenticity
